Output 8dc24dee65d7707ce6278d4bfa9cd053ab2658a09f78c3d1b1c371308504f08f:1

value
879157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42e24377655cc0709e666316cc47a88ef66103e1 OP_EQUAL
address
37nfaGfoDq4kGGQoU42kpDnRmFcioH2MDr
transaction
8dc24dee65d7707ce6278d4bfa9cd053ab2658a09f78c3d1b1c371308504f08f
confirmations
243914
spent
true